I use strong 1mm Stretch Magic cord for my bracelets. I always pre stretch the cord, add the beads, triple knot, glue the knot and tuck it into a complimentary larger hole bead.
I suggest to ALWAYS Roll On your stretch bracelet.
My bracelet sizing is as follows:
Measure your wrist and add 1/2 to 3/4 inch. Think about where you want the particular bracelet to hang - snug, a bit loose or looser to wear lower on your hand.
Example: my wrist measures 6.75" in length
A 7” length is tight but wearable
A 7.25” length is the size I prefer
A 7.50” length is doable, a bit looser but still wearable
In my opinion, 1/2 inch larger than your wrist circumference is the perfect size. Sometimes the bracelet seems too small trying to get over the larger part of the hand but if you slowly roll on the bracelet, the fit is perfect.
